Do disciplinary warnings expire?

The Acas Non-Statutory Manual: Workplace Discipline and Complaints, which accompanies the Code, states that warnings should generally only be valid for a certain period of time, such as six months for the first written notice and 12 months for the last written notice. .

What are the basic principles of disciplinary procedure?

The purpose of the disciplinary process is to encourage and maintain standards of conduct and to ensure fair and equitable treatment for all. It should allow the employer to seek an informal solution if necessary, but allow a more formal procedure when circumstances warrant disciplinary action.
